Freedom Implores Fresh Start

Again, I was freed from a mad hurricane Call it by any name, it's still the same Two eldest siblings, lost their lives in the dark Freedom implores fresh start. I needed to search, to find the right key To set free, the rainbow that is me I lied, and lived life as pseudo art Freedom implores fresh start. I wove my very own hand-made strife Piled firewood burned my studious life I was flown to the U.S., to carve life like a star Freedom implores fresh start. Meanwhile, my two eldest siblings made the family proud From in the days of carefree years, I'd known dark clouds Sometimes discombobulated, I couldn't see far Freedom implores fresh start. Until sky-light rain song transported my soul, as I wept Until I envisioned my better self in depth I never saw love, and life from God, as supreme art Freedom implores fresh start. Now, I live to learn, and hope my lessons show I can pause and ponder where I choose to go I'll wake and meditate, keeping light my heart Freedom implores fresh start. *
